Alan Pope 🍺🐧🐱 πŸ¦„ 2016-04-14 Needs Fixing on 2016-05-07
Jenkins Bot continuous-integration Approve on 2016-04-14
Commit message

Save imported files from content-hub in a separate folder.

Description of the change

Save imported files from content-hub in a separate folder.

review: Approve (continuous-integration)

This doesn't work as expected.

Downloaded PDF from browser. Tap Open when done, get an error on Docviewer, and the file isn't saved. (no new files in ~/Documents on device)

Here's a video showing it.

review: Needs Fixing

That happens also with the release currently available on the store (i.e. does not depend on this MP). If docviewer is already launched, everything works as expected.

In the log is there anything about Libertine containers? I started to see this problem when content-hub has added the support for xmir apps.
It happens only with docviewer though, I'll have a look (I suspect the QML Loader[1] causes the issue).


Preview Diff

1=== modified file 'src/plugin/file-qml-plugin/docviewerutils.cpp'
2--- src/plugin/file-qml-plugin/docviewerutils.cpp 2015-12-27 12:10:06 +0000
3+++ src/plugin/file-qml-plugin/docviewerutils.cpp 2016-04-14 17:29:33 +0000
4@@ -91,7 +91,7 @@
5 if (suffix.isEmpty())
6 suffix = mt.preferredSuffix();
8- QString dir = QStandardPaths::writableLocation(QStandardPaths::DocumentsLocation) + QDir::separator();
9+ QString dir = QStandardPaths::writableLocation(QStandardPaths::DocumentsLocation) + QDir::separator() + "Imported" + QDir::separator();
10 QString destination = QString("%1.%2").arg(dir + filenameWithoutSuffix, suffix);
12 // If there's already a file of this name, reformat it to


